If the substrate advance is incorrectly adjusted, particularly if it is under-advancing, a dark line can appear between passes. When the problem of line roughness or text quality applies to all colors and appears in the substrate axis direction, it is likely to be related to incorrect substrate advance. Another clue that could point to substrate advance as a cause is to observe that the defect is not constant, appearing and disappearing along the print in the substrate axis. To confirm it, see Substrate-advance verification on page 137. To correct the substrate advance, see Substrate-advance compensation on page 134. In most cases, this will solve the problem. However, you are recommended to run the OMAS Diagnostic Tests from the maintenance window as soon as the substrate is unloaded, to avoid having the same problem with other substrates. See Clean the substrate-advance sensor on page 174. ● Printhead-to-substrate spacing. Check the printhead-to-substrate spacing in the Internal Print Server. If it is higher than normal, try reducing it. Graininess The print shows a higher level of grain than expected, either throughout the print or in some specific areas. The example below shows more grain in the lower half than in the upper half. This can occur for various different reasons: ● Coalescence. Some substrates, in some particular conditions, can produce a type of grain due to wetting issues. For example, in high humidity or low temperature environments, the ink may not dry fast enough in fast print modes, producing a grainy effect on the print. The example below shows worse coalescence on the right-hand side. It is difficult to decide whether this kind of problem is due to wetting or to dot placement error (described below). The type of grain could be a clue: in the case of wetting issues, dots tend to aggregate into bigger dots, with empty spaces in between. A magnifying glass can be useful to examine the print in more detail. Graininess 287
